Factors to Consider When Choosing Best Professional Stereo Microscope With Camera For Small Design Studios
Choosing the right stereo microscope with a camera for a small design studio involves understanding several core factors. Beyond basic specs, you should evaluate how well the microscope integrates into your workflow, how user-friendly it is, and whether it offers enough flexibility for your specific projects. The right choice depends on your budget, the level of detail required, and whether you prioritize ease of use or advanced customization. Keep these considerations in mind to make an informed decision that supports your design process effectively.Optical Quality and Magnification Range
High-quality optics are essential for accurate, detailed inspections. Look for microscopes offering sharp, distortion-free images at various magnifications—typically from around 3.5X to 90X or higher. A broader magnification range provides greater versatility for different design tasks, whether inspecting small components or larger assemblies. Avoid models with cheap lenses, as they can compromise image clarity and lead to eye strain during extended use.
Camera Resolution and Compatibility
The camera’s resolution directly influences the level of detail you can capture. In small design studios, an 8MP to 20MP camera is generally recommended, with higher resolutions offering crisper images for precise work. Compatibility with your operating system and existing software is also vital; ensure the microscope’s camera connects easily via USB and supports your preferred image editing tools. A well-integrated camera simplifies capturing, editing, and sharing your work efficiently.
Lighting and Illumination Options
Consistent, adjustable lighting makes a noticeable difference in image quality. LED ring lights are common and preferred for their brightness, energy efficiency, and longevity. Some microscopes include multiple lighting modes or dimming controls, which help in reducing glare and shadows on reflective surfaces. Avoid models with insufficient or uneven lighting, as this can obscure details or cause eye fatigue over long sessions.
Build Quality and Stability
For small studios, stability is often overlooked but remains critical. A sturdy stand or boom arm minimizes vibrations and allows precise positioning. Look for models with high-quality materials and smooth adjustment mechanisms. Cheaper plastic stands or flimsy bases can lead to instability, making delicate work difficult and increasing the risk of equipment damage.
Ease of Use and Setup
Ease of use encompasses straightforward assembly, intuitive controls, and minimal calibration time. Some models come pre-assembled and feature user-friendly interfaces, which are ideal for busy studios or those new to microscopy. More advanced setups with extensive customization options may require additional training or technical knowledge, so consider your team’s expertise before opting for complex systems.
Price and Value
While investing in high-end microscopes offers advanced features, it’s important to match your budget with your needs. Overpaying for capabilities you won’t use wastes resources, but skimping on quality can lead to frustration and subpar results. Focus on models that strike a balance between performance and affordability, providing long-term value for your studio’s workflow.
Frequently Asked Questions
Can I upgrade the camera later if I need higher resolution?
Many stereo microscopes with integrated cameras allow for upgrades, but compatibility varies. Some models have standard USB ports and support external cameras, making it easier to upgrade later. However, integrated cameras are often built into the system, limiting upgrade options. It’s best to choose a model with a high-resolution camera from the start if image quality is a priority, or confirm compatibility before purchasing a system with an upgrade path.
What magnification range is most suitable for small design work?
For small design studios, a magnification range of approximately 10X to 90X covers most detailed inspection needs. This allows viewing both small components and larger assemblies without frequent switching lenses. If your work involves extremely tiny details, consider models with higher maximum magnification. Conversely, if you primarily work on larger prototypes, a narrower range might suffice, simplifying the setup and use.
Is LED lighting sufficient, or should I consider other options?
LED lighting is generally sufficient for most small studio applications due to its brightness, energy efficiency, and longevity. Adjustable LED ring lights help achieve even illumination, reducing glare and shadows. In some cases, additional light sources or fiber optic lighting may be necessary for highly reflective or translucent samples. However, for most design tasks, quality LED lighting provides a reliable, maintenance-free solution.
How important is the ergonomic design of the microscope for long sessions?
Ergonomics plays a significant role in reducing fatigue during extended use. Features like adjustable eyepieces, comfortable stands, and tilt or swivel capabilities help maintain proper posture. Models with ergonomic focus controls or foot pedals can also improve workflow efficiency. Prioritizing ergonomic design ensures you can work comfortably for longer periods without strain or discomfort, which is especially valuable in small studio environments.
Should I prioritize a larger magnification or better image quality?
Both are important, but the choice depends on your specific needs. High magnification can reveal tiny details, but if the optics are poor, the image may be blurry or distorted. Conversely, excellent image quality at lower to moderate magnifications often suffices for most design tasks, providing clarity without sacrificing usability. For precise, detailed inspections, prioritize models with superior optics and resolution, even if the maximum magnification is moderate.
